~~ <br />Hot-water Soluble_ <br />• (ASA Agxrmany No. 9, Methods of Soil Analysis) <br />Page two - - <br />Procedure , Cont' d. <br />6. Add 5 ml of the Ca(OH)2 suspension to both the samples and standart3s and <br />evaporate to dryness in a drying ovPSS at 55°C. <br />7. Add 1 drop of pd~olphthalein indicator and .5 ml of 2.5 N HC1. If the <br />solution remains pink, add HC1 dropwise until the solution is clear. <br />8. Add 4 ml of the c~sclanin - oxalic acid solution and rotate the beaker to <br />bring the solution into contact with all of the sample. <br />9. Place the sample and standard beakers in a water bath so that about 1/Z" <br />of the beaker is in the water. Evaporate the solutions to dryness at <br />55°C ± 3°C. Remove the beakers from the bath 15 minutes after becoming dry. <br />10. Pbisten the residue with alcohol, using a wash bottle. Transfer the con- <br />tents to a 50 ml centrifuge with additional alcohol, using a rubber police- <br />man to aid in transfer. Keep total wlume below 25 ml. <br /> 11. Centrifuge the solution for 10 minutes at 2000 RPM. Decant the solution <br />• into a 25 ml wlumetric flask and add alcohol to bring th wlimie. <br />12. Measure the absorbance of the standards on the D-U spectrophotometer at <br />540 mu. Zero the instrument by using the blank prepared with the standards. <br />The absorbance reading obtained on the blank sample solution should be sub- <br />tracted from the sample readings. <br />13. Find the concentration of boron in the test solution by reference to the <br />calibration curve and calculate the boron onntent in the original sample. <br />The color is stable for 1-2 hours. <br />-~ <br />14. Standards should be nm with each batch of samples. <br />Calculations <br />C~ <br />ppm water soluble boron in sample = 4 x ug concentration for <br />calibration curve <br />The above foa!atla is derived fr+mn: <br />x = ug from calibration crave <br />x ug/ml = <br />20x ug/20 ml = <br />20x ug/5 g = <br />4 x ug/g = <br />4 x ppm boron in sample <br />6-56 <br />
